Records management and collecting policies
The Golden and District Museum acquires, preserves and makes accessible archival material relating to Golden and other communities in the Columbia region of B.C., including Field, Donald, Parson, Harrogate, Spillimacheen, and Brisco. Holdings include records of schools and school boards, individuals, institutions and community associations, the Town of Golden, and the Golden Assessment District. The museum also maintains an extensive historical photograph collection.
Buildings
Holdings
Total Volume: approx. 8 linear metres<br /> Inclusive Dates: 1890-1990<br /> Predominant Dates: 1895-1979
